Ferry suffered broken gearbox

Tue Apr 01 10:02:37 CEST 2025 Timsen

The fault, which has kept the 'Tunøfærgen ' in the port of Hov since March 27, has now been located in the port of Hov, being related to a gearbox. The ferry operator hopes that the ferry can be back in service from April 3. Technicians have been working to find the fault together with employees from Hundested Propeller, who at one time had supplied the ship's gears, among other things. The investigations have shown that the port side gear has broken. So now a major repair was started by the ferry operator. Until the Tunø ferry is back in operation, the 'Ternen' will be responsible for the ferry service to the island. However, the 'Ternen' only has room for 12 passengers, and also has other tasks to solve, such as maintaining the wind turbines on Tunø Rev and the turbines at Samsø in the coming days. Therefore, the exact times for the ferry sailings could not be given. If there is an acute space problem, it is possible to deploy an even smaller ship, the 'Ternen 2', which, however, only has room for six passengers, while the 'Tunøfærgen' has a capacity of more than 100 passengers, and also space for four cars.

Ferry suffered propeller problems

Sat Mar 29 14:05:22 CET 2025 Timsen

The 'Tunøfærgen', sailing between Hou and Tunø, suffered a problem with the port side propeller during an approach on March27, 2025. Therefore the ferry cannot sail at the moment. Technicians have been trying to repair the ferry all March 28, but they have not been able to solve the problem. The ferry will therefore not sail all weekend and on March 31. As areplacement the ferry the 'Ternen' has been deployed on the route between Hou and Tunø. However, the MS Ternen only has room for 12 passengers, so initially the seats will be reserved for people who live on Tunø, informed the Odder Municipality, which is responsible for ferry operations. - Those who may have bought tickets for the ferry over the weekend will be notified in due course. The Ternen will sail according to the normal timetable over the weekend, but it may vary from March 31. Customers were an eye on the Tunø ferry website for departure times.
